cPanel / WHM is a comprehensive website hosting suite designed to simplify and centralize the management of web servers and hosted websites. It is widely used by hosting providers, system administrators, and businesses because it brings together a broad set of tools into a single, cohesive interface. By abstracting many complex server tasks into intuitive graphical controls, cPanel / WHM allows users to manage hosting environments efficiently without requiring deep command-line expertise, while still supporting advanced configurations for experienced administrators.
At its core, the platform is divided into two primary components: WebHost Manager (WHM) and cPanel. WHM operates at the server and reseller level, providing administrators with control over account creation, resource allocation, security policies, and server-wide settings. cPanel, on the other hand, is the end-user interface that enables website owners to manage their domains, email accounts, databases, files, and applications. This separation of responsibilities allows hosting environments to scale effectively while maintaining clear boundaries between administrative and user-level access.
Webmin is a web-based system administration and hosting management platform designed primarily for Unix-like operating systems, including Linux and BSD. Unlike commercial hosting control panels, Webmin is open source and emphasizes flexibility, transparency, and direct interaction with underlying system services. It provides administrators with a browser-accessible interface to configure and manage servers, reducing the need to perform many routine tasks manually from the command line while still preserving fine-grained control over system behavior.
At a foundational level, Webmin acts as a graphical front end to standard system configuration files and services. It allows administrators to manage users and groups, configure networking, control system services, and monitor resource usage. Because Webmin typically modifies native configuration files rather than abstracting them behind proprietary layers, changes made through the interface closely reflect how the system is actually configured. This makes Webmin particularly appealing to administrators who want visibility into and control over the operating system itself.
Angular stands out as a superior technology for web development for several reasons, primarily due to its comprehensive framework capabilities that address a wide array of development needs out of the box. Unlike many other libraries or frameworks that require external libraries for functionalities like routing, forms handling, or dependency injection, Angular provides these features natively.
This coherence significantly streamlines the development process, as developers can rely on a unified toolset and best practices that Angular promotes. Moreover, Angular's emphasis on TypeScript offers a more structured and type-safe development environment, enhancing code quality and maintainability. Its two-way data binding feature ensures that changes in the application state are immediately reflected in the view and vice versa, making it easier to create dynamic and responsive user interfaces.
The Angular CLI further elevates its superiority by automating many tasks, such as project scaffolding and build optimization, allowing developers to focus more on creating high-quality applications rather than on configuring or managing their development environment. These attributes make Angular a compelling choice for enterprises and individual developers looking for a robust, efficient, and scalable solution for modern web development.
Node.js's magic lies in its ability to power both the front and back-end of websites using the familiar JavaScript language. This simplifies development, reduces context switching, and fosters smoother collaboration. But its perks extend beyond developer convenience.
Node.js shines in real-time applications, handling data streams and user interactions with lightning speed. Its event-driven architecture scales beautifully, effortlessly accommodating growing traffic and evolving needs. And finally, the vast and vibrant Node.js community generates a constant stream of libraries and frameworks, empowering developers to build feature-rich, dynamic websites at warp speed.
In short, Node.js isn't just a technology, it's a productivity superpower for web development.
Web hosting with Python offers numerous advantages, especially for developers seeking versatility and efficiency in modern web development. Python's robust ecosystem of web frameworks, such as Django and Flask, allows for rapid development, clean code structuring, and powerful scalability for complex web applications.
Additionally, Python's seamless integration with artificial intelligence (AI) tools and large language models (LLMs) makes it an ideal choice for hosting AI-driven web services, chatbots, recommendation engines, and advanced analytics platforms. By leveraging Python's rich libraries and frameworks alongside its interoperability with AI APIs and machine learning libraries like TensorFlow or PyTorch, developers can build highly interactive and intelligent web applications that deliver cutting-edge user experiences.
This combination of web and AI capabilities positions Python as a leading choice for hosting innovative and future-ready web solutions.
WordPress, widely recognized for its prowess as a content management system (CMS), offers remarkable flexibility that extends beyond hosting dynamic websites to crafting robust APIs. Through its REST API, WordPress enables developers to create and expose custom APIs, thereby transforming WordPress sites into data sources that can be consumed by other web applications, mobile apps, and services.
This feature empowers developers to seamlessly integrate WordPress content with external systems, fostering an ecosystem where content can be distributed and utilized in innovative ways. Additionally, the platform's extensibility through plugins and themes allows for the customization of both the front-end experience and the API endpoints, tailoring them to specific project requirements.
This dual capability makes WordPress an exemplary choice for developers looking to both host websites with rich content management features and develop APIs that can serve a wide range of applications, ensuring data consistency and accessibility across various digital products.
